Subject: Accept Donation - Resurfacing Basketball Courts at Belafonte Tacolcy Center
Purpose of Item:
Resolution authorizing the City Manager to accept a donation from BIU Inc. at an
estimated value of $44,500.00 in the form of basketball court resurfacing at Belafonte
Tacolcy Park, a City owned property located at 6161 NW 9th Street, Miami, FL 33127;
further authorizing the City Manager to execute necessary documents, amendments,
extensions, and modifications in a form acceptable to the City attorney, to implement
the acceptance of said donation.
Background of Item:
The Department of Parks and Recreation has been selected to receive a donation
valued at $44,500 from BIU, Inc. to resurface a basketball court for the purpose of
facilitation youth and adult basketball activities at Belafonte Tacolcy Park in conjunction
with Miami Art Week. The artwork placed on the newly resurfaced court will incorporate
trademarked logos and/or designs. This resolution accepts the donation, and authorizes
the City Manager to execute all necessary documents to accept the donation. All costs
associated with this project will be paid directly by BIU,Inc. and the project will be at no
cost to the City.

WHEREAS, the City of Miami ("City") owns the property located at 6161 Northwest 9
Avenue, Miami, Florida, known as Belafonte Tacolcy Center; and
WHEREAS, BIU, Inc., a for -profit corporation ("BIU"), wishes to donate equipment and
improvements with an estimated value of $44,500.00 to the City for Belafonte Tacolcy Center
and wishes to place a sign or advertising therein; and
WHEREAS, the City desires to enter into an agreement for the acceptance of
equipment, whereby BIU will grant and donate certain equipment to the City to be utilized at
Belafonte Tacolcy Center and for the placement of a sign or advertisement therein;
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E COMMISSION OF THE CITY OF
MIAMI, FLORIDA:
Section 1. The recitals and findings contained in the Preamble of this Resolution are
adopted by reference incorporated as if fully set forth in this Section.
Section 2. By a four -fifths (4/5ths) affirmative vote, after an advertised public hearing,
the City Manager's recommendation and written finding, attached and incorporated as Exhibit
"A," pursuant to Section 18-86 of the Code of the City of Miami, Florida, as amended, are
ratified, confirmed, and approved and the requirements for competitive sealed bidding methods
are waived as not practicable or advantageous to the City to use for the placement of a sign or
advertising from BIU within Belafonte Tacolcy Center.
Section 3. The City Manager is authorized' to accept a donation from BIU at an
estimated value of $44,500.00 in the form of equipment and improvements at Belafonte Tacolcy
Center.
Section 4. The City Manager is further authorized' to negotiate and execute a donation
agreement, in a form acceptable to the City Attorney, with BIU for the placement of a sign or
advertisement and the acceptance of the resurfaced basketball court at Belafonte Tacolcy
Center.
Section 5. The City Manager is further authorized' to negotiate and execute any other
necessary documents, all in a form acceptable to the City Attorney, in order to implement the
acceptance of said donation.
Section 6. This Resolution shall become effective immediately upon its adoption and
signature of the Mayor.2
